The saga of Y&R Argentina’s ‘Malvinas’ ad for the Argentine government that has so annoyed (among others) the British government, WPP’s Sir Martin Sorrell, hapless and seemingly helpless network managers at Y&R and the International Olympic Committee, has taken a couple of new twists. The controversial London Olympics ad by Y&R Argentina claiming the UK-owned Falkland Islands are actually the Argentine Malvinas (the cause of a shooting war between the two countries 30 year ago) is still running on Argentine TV (and all over the internet) despite demands from an increasingly panic-stricken WPP (Y&R’s owner) to pull it.
